Maharashtra Deputy Chief Minister Eknath Shinde has dismissed reports of a rift within the ruling Mahayuti alliance, stating that "everything is hunky-dory." He attributed any issues to differences that will be resolved through discussions. Shinde's comments come after reports of him complaining to Union Home Minister Amit Shah about Deputy Chief Minister Ajit Pawar, who heads the Nationalist Congress Party (NCP). However, Pawar and BJP leader Sudhir Mungantiwar have denied the allegations, claiming Shinde would have directly approached them if there were any issues. The ruling alliance comprises the BJP, Shiv Sena, and NCP, which retained power after the state assembly polls last year. The alliance has also faced challenges with the appointment of guardian ministers in Raigad and Nashik, with the Shiv Sena opposing the appointments of Aditi Tatkare (NCP) and Girish Mahajan (BJP).
